The registry I am trying to start is only for header fields, not for HTML
elements. However, a registry for HTML element might also be useful.
My proposal for the header field registry can be found at URL:
ftp://ftp.dsv.su.se/users/jpalme/draft-ietf-drums-MHRegistry-03.txt
An example of how the header field registry could look like can be found
at URL:
http://www.dsv.su.se/~jpalme/ietf/iana-header-field-registry.html
So far, I have only produced an incomplete list of e-mail headers,
which would be the basis of developing the starting set for the
header-field registry. That incomplete list can be found at URL:
ftp://ds.internic.net/rfc/rfc2076.txt, I plan to submit a revised
version shortly, but still only containing e-mail and netnews,
not HTTP header fields.
If you reply to this message with comments which I should read, then
include me in the recipient list, since I am not a subscriber to
the http-wg mailing list. There is also a specific mailing list
for the header registry issue. This mailing list is presently not
active, but could of course become active and be used for a discussion
of header field registry issues, and possibly also HTML tag registry
issues. The list is named "mail-headers", since initially we planned
a registry for only e-mail header fields, but now we believe that
the internet community is best served by a common registry for
e-mail, netnews and http header fields.
